James Hetfield Explains Why Metallica Doesn’t Do Politics

June 22, 2023 Dustin Peterson News, Video Comments Off on James Hetfield Explains Why Metallica Doesn’t Do Politics

James Hetfield of Metallica is undoubtedly heavy metal royalty. The good people at Clip Em All put together a reel of James discussing why the band does not dabble in politics – despite their very political record “… And Justice For All.”
